495 results about "Sclerotinia sclerotiorum" patented technology

Sclerotinia sclerotiorum is a plant pathogenic fungus and can cause a disease called white mold if conditions are conducive. S. sclerotiorum can also be known as cottony rot, watery soft rot, stem rot, drop, crown rot and blossom blight. A key characteristic of this pathogen is its ability to produce black resting structures known as sclerotia and white fuzzy growths of mycelium on the plant it infects. These sclerotia give rise to a fruiting body in the spring that produces spores in a sac which is why fungi in this class are called sac fungi (Ascomycetes). This pathogen can occur on many continents and has a wide host range of plants. When S. sclerotiorum is onset in the field by favorable environmental conditions, losses can be great and control measures should be considered.

Bacillus amyloliquefaciens with phosphate solubilizing, disease preventing and growth promoting functions and application thereof

The invention relates to bacillus amyloliquefaciens which has stronger phosphate solubilizing and plant growth promoting functions and has a better preventing and treating effect on various plant diseases. According to the bacillus amyloliquefaciens JCD-H-12 with the phosphate solubilizing, disease preventing and growth promoting functions, disclosed by the invention, the preservation number is CGMCC NO.11856, the preservation date is December 10, 2015, and multiple effects of solubilizing phosphate, preventing diseases, promoting the growth, increasing the yield and the quality, having a broad bacteriostatic spectrum and the like are obtained; a bacterial strain and inoculant of the bacterial strain are capable of effectively preventing and treating powdery mildew, tobacco black shank, botrytis blight, rice blast, cucumber fusarium wilt, tomato early blight, sweet pepper anthracnose, watermelon sclerotinia sclerotiorum, wheat scab, watermelon fusarium wilt, phytophthora capsici and the like; a broad-spectrum antibacterial effect is obtained, the effect is stable and durable, and the bacillus amyloliquefaciens can be developed into a bacterial fertilizer and microbial pesticide preparation which integrates phosphate solubilizing with disease preventing and treating.

Biocontrol bacteria strain preventing and curing plant disease

The invention provides a biocontrol bacterial strain for preventing and treating plant diseases and its bacterial agent, belonging to the field of biological control. The strains used are Gram-negative bacteria, identified as Lysobacter enzymogenes, and the strain code is OH11. Strain OH11 has no flagella but has slippage, can produce various extracellular hydrolytic enzymes including chitinase, β-1,3-glucanase and protease, and can effectively inhibit the growth of fungi and bacteria. The antibacterial zone diameters of strain OH11 against Sclerotinia sclerotiorum and Phytophthora capsici were both greater than 22.0 mm; the antagonism against potato ring rot was stronger, and the diameter of the inhibition zone reached 50 mm. The OH11 strain was inoculated into the seed tank, cultivated to the logarithmic growth phase, and the seed liquid was connected to the production tank for cultivation. The medium used in the production tank was the same as that of the seed tank. The liquid fermentation adopts aerobic submerged fermentation and fed-batch process, the dissolved oxygen is 15%-20%, the fermentation temperature is 30°C, the fermentation time is 72h, and the initial pH value is 7.5. After the fermentation is completed, the culture solution is taken out of the tank and directly packed into liquid dosage forms with plastic packaging barrels or packaging bottles, or subpackaged into solid dosage forms with peat adsorption packaging bags. The biocontrol strain OH11 can effectively control plant pathogenic fungi, bacteria, nematodes and other diseases, and the overall control effect is 50%-70%. In the greenhouse pot experiment, the control effects of OH11 on pepper blight and tomato bacterial wilt reached 83.6% and 86.4%, respectively. Strain OH11 has the characteristics of broad antibacterial spectrum, high activity, and environmental safety. In today's serious pesticide pollution, zymolysobacterium and its bacterial agent will be a good substitute.

Broad-spectrum disease resisting, growth promotion and stress resisting bacillus capable of preventing and treating tomato gray mold and tomato leaf mold and application of broad-spectrum disease resisting, growth promotion and stress resisting bacillus

The invention discloses broad-spectrum disease resisting, growth promotion and stress resisting bacillus capable of preventing and treating tomato gray mold and tomato leaf mold and application of the broad-spectrum disease resisting, growth promotion and stress resisting bacillus. The broad-spectrum disease resisting, growth promotion and stress resisting bacillus is bacillus sp. WXCDD105, and is preserved in China General Microbiological Culture Collection Center (CGMCC); the preservation address is 3, No.1 Yard, Western Beichen Road, Chaoyang District, Beijing, the preservation date is May 25, 2016, and the preservation number is CGMCC No.12496. A biocontrol strain provided by the invention has ultraviolet-resisting and drought-resisting properties, has stronger prevention and treatment effects on the tomato gray mold and the tomato leaf mold, and can inhibit fungal diseases including wilt fusarium of a plurality of types of crops, corn foot root bacteria, rice wilt pathogens, acanthopanax senticosus root rot pathogens, corynespora cassiicolai, colletrichum orbiculare, exserohilum turcicum, tomato spot blight fungi, sunflower sclerotinia sclerotiorum, botrytis cinerea, fusarium oxysporum, verticillium fusarium, alternaria alternata and the like; the broad-spectrum disease resisting, growth promotion and stress resisting bacillus has a growth promotion effect on tomato seeds and seedlings and can also improve the quality of fruits and reduce the rotting rate.

Early stage rapid molecular detection method for rape sclerotinia rot

The invention belongs to the plant diseases molecular detection field and relates to the early rapid molecular detection method of sclerotinia rot of colza. The invention is characterized by comprising the collection of weazen rapeseed petals, extraction of total DNA of rapeseed petals, nest-PCR, PCR amplification product analysis, agarose gel electrophoresis and result judgement. If sclerotinia sclerotiorum exists in a sample, a 292bp purpose bank may appear in the agarose gel under ultraviolet light, or else, the sclerotinia sclerotiorum does not exist. The primers of the invention can not only distinguish common plant leaf pathogenic fungi of distance relationship and different categories, such as alternaria genus alternaria sp, fusarium genus fusarium graminearum and coniothyrium genus sclerotinia sclerotiorum sclerotia coniothyrium parasitic fungi, but also can distinguish various fungi of common plant leaf fungal pathogen botrytis also belonging to ascomycotina, discomycete and helotiales with the sclerotinia species; the invention has high sensitivity, can detect the sclerotinia sclerotiorum DNA with the limit of 1fg/Mul, is rapid, and can obtain accurate detection result within 7 hours, however, at least two days or more than 1 week is needed for obtaining the detection result by using the traditional microbiology method.

Aryl triazole compound containing chlorinated cyclopropane and preparation method and application thereof

The invention discloses an aryl triazole compound containing chlorinated cyclopropane and a preparation method and application thereof. The structural formula of the aryl triazole compound containing chlorinated cyclopropane is shown in formula I, wherein X represents C=O or CHOH, and R represents a substituent phenyl group; the substituent in the substituent phenyl group is any one of the following groups: halogen, methyl group, methoxyl group, nitro group, trifluoromethyl group, amino group, and acetyl amino group. The preparation method, provided by the invention, adopts cheap raw materials, and takes a simple reaction route; the synthesized compound has both plant growth regulating activity and bactericidal activity, thereby having a wider application range; in application experiments of the aryl triazole compound containing chlorinated cyclopropane, the plant growth regulating activity shows that the synthesized compound manifests excellent plant growth regulating activity; in application experiments of the aryl triazole compound containing chlorinated cyclopropane, the bactericidal activity test result shows that the compound has excellent growth inhibition effect on sclerotinia sclerotiorum, tomato fungus phytophthora, botrytis cinerea, rhizoctonia solani seedbed, blast fungus, asparagus stem blight, fusarium graminearum, pythium germs, and the like.
